LG UM7300 design

LG may offer some impressive designs on its premium sets, only the LG UM7300 is far more than restrained. The pattern is simple, with mesomorphic blackness bezels around the screen, a basic stand up and a black plastic rear panel that is more often than not featureless, but tapers around the tiptop and sides for a less boxy wait.

(Image credit: LG)

Measuring 57.6 10 33.5 x 3.v inches without the stand, the UM7300 is big enough that you'll need a second person to help ready it up. The UM7300 is a flake thick, measuring nearly 3.5 inches through virtually of its chassis.

(Image credit: LG)

While this provides plenty of room for the internal components and speakers, it does hateful that the UM7300 isn't well suited to wall mounting, since information technology will stick out from the wall by several inches. However, if you practice wish to hang it on the wall, the UM7300 will accommodate a 300 ten 300-millimeter VESA mount. The 65-inch UM7300 weighs 47 pounds.

LG UM7300 ports

The UM7300PUA is outfitted with iii HDMI ports, 2 USB ports, a coaxial connector for hooking upwards an antenna and combination component and composite video inputs. In that location's a LAN port for connecting to your home network via Ethernet, simply the TV also has 802.11ac Wi-Fi congenital in.

(Image credit: LG)

The inputs are divided between a left-facing side console, which has two HDMI ports and one USB, and a rear-facing panel for the balance of the ports. For those using a soundbar, the second HDMI port also supports audio render channel, (sometimes chosen HDMI ARC), letting you lot use a single HDMI connection for all of the audio.

LG UM7300 performance

The LG UM7300 is an exercise in delivering the basics, giving you some (but non all) of the features you lot'd expect from a 4K TV. The 65-inch display provides full 3840 ten 2160 resolution and looks fairly good for well-nigh content. But at that place were some existent bug that stood out as I began watching exam samples on the 65-inch Boob tube.

(Image credit: LG)

The first was colour quality. Watching scenes from Spider-Man: Homecoming, the colors all seemed slightly washed out, with skintones coming beyond slightly pale, and reds and blues non looking quite as vibrant as they should.

The LG UM7300 is an practice in delivering the basics, giving you some (but not all) of the features yous'd expect from a 4K TV.

Our lab tests dorsum upward my initial impressions. When measured using our Ten-Rite colorimeter, the UM7300 reproduced only 97.9% of the Rec 709 color space. While that'southward not far off from other affordable sets nosotros've tested, similar the TCL 55S425 (97.2%) and the Samsung RU7100 50-inch (96.iii%), it's a noticable divergence from the excellent Vizio M-Serial Quantum (99.ix%), which is far closer to the 100% nosotros expect from a 4K Goggle box.

Color accuracy measurements gave us improve numbers, with the UN7300 delivering a Delta-East rating of 1.9 (closer to zero is better). While that'due south better than the Vizio One thousand-Series Quantum (3.6), it's but a tad more authentic than the Samsung RU7100 (2.0) and actually less precise than the TCL 55S425 (1.4).

Thanks to the Tv'south IPS screen, you'll be able to enjoy the picture from a variety of angles, with minimal color shifting when viewed from the side. However, IPS displays are notoriously poor performers when it comes to black levels, and nosotros saw this on the UM7300 likewise.

The UM7300 has directly backlighting, with lights positioned backside the LCD panel, as opposed to border-lit positions often used for the backlighting on less expensive TVs. Withal, without local dimming, the high dynamic range (HDR) operation is very express, and the aforementioned blackness-level performance is brought farther to the forefront by the brightness offered past the backlight. Format support is also restricted to HDR10 and hybrid log gamma (HLG) content, with no support for more than premium formats, like Dolby Vision. With no local dimming, brights can ramp upwardly pretty high, but the overall dissimilarity isn't neat. All of the blacks and shadows are subsequently washed out, presenting as a glowing grayness instead.

Watching a scene from Creed Ii, as the fighters enter the arena, the entrances are filled with bright lights, pyres of flame and laser lights, just instead of presenting intense highlights against the dark environs, these elements lost a lot of their impact as the darkness lost its depth and the contrasting elements lost their crispness. The overall HDR performance still delivered a amend moving-picture show than you'd get on an older standard dynamic range Television, merely it was nowhere almost as impressive as what we routinely come across on even more modestly priced HDR-enabled sets.

I also saw some mediocre motion handling. Whether it was the web-slinging action of Spider-Man: Homecoming, or the flying fists of Creed II, fast motion introduced many unwanted artifacts, and hazy smearing was easy to see whenever something moved chop-chop on-screen. Switching to cinema mode and turning on motion smoothing reduced these problems, simply not completely. In every fashion, I saw hasty motion instead of smoothness and smearing instead of crisp detail.

LG UM7300 gaming

1 area where the UM7300 delivers a pretty great feel is in gaming. When we connected our Xbox One X to the set, we were pleasantly surprised to see the TV automatically detect the game console and switched over to a special deep-color mode that supports the 10-bit colour offered by the console.

(Image credit: LG)

With a response fourth dimension of just 12.1 milliseconds, it'south the most responsive TV for gaming we've tested all year.

Overall back up was good but carries the same limitations as the TV itself. Gaming in 4K and 60 Hz is set to become, and streaming content will support diverse frame rates (24, 50 and 60 Hz), just HDR support is limited to HDR10. Equally with regular content, the TV merely doesn't back up Dolby Vision.

LG UM7300 audio quality

With a pair of xx-watt speakers inside to provide 2-channel sound, the UM7300 doesn't provide the greatest sound quality. It also doesn't get very loud, and the lack of subwoofer is noticeable in the wimpy bass.

(Image credit: LG)

Listening to the title fight in Creed II, the dialogue betwixt boxers and coaches was clear and easy to distinguish, but the fight – which features several depression-cease sounds, like the bear on of punches and the roar of the crowded loonshit – lacked a lot of the impact information technology should have had. Overall sound quality was fairly clear and distortion gratis, and the samples of the Rocky theme vocal that play during the fight came through conspicuously, but again lacked oomph, even at higher volumes.

This is definitely 1 set where we recommend adding a soundbar to your home theater setup.

LG UM7300 smart features

One area where the UM7300 doesn't compromise at all is in the smart TV experience. LG's webOS is 1 of our favorite smart TV platforms, thank you to its slick navigation and decent app choice. A broad selection in the app store ways that you'll accept access to every popular streaming service, from Netflix and Hulu to Pluto Television and YouTube Idiot box.

(Epitome credit: LG)

LG's webOS is one of our favorite smart Television set platforms, thanks to its slick navigation and decent app selection.

Phonation control is too built in, with Google Assistant integrated into the ThinQ AI features; it tin can be used for everything from content search to pulling upward online data on stocks and weather.

Simply LG has expanded the voice interaction in 2019, offering a second vocalization assistant, Amazon Alexa. This makes it 1 of the few TVs that let y'all employ Alexa without pairing a separate Alexa-enabled device (like the Amazon Echo Dot) to do and then.

The latest version of webOS besides includes a tool chosen Home Dashboard, which aims to make the TV the central hub of your connected home. Everything from your smart thermostat and laundry machines to the all-time video doorbells and connected lightbulbs can be set to work on the TV, letting you see who's at the door or conform the mood lighting from the comfort of your couch.

LG UM7300 remote control

The LG Magic Remote is the same on the UM7300 as information technology is on LG's more premium models, similar the LG C9 OLED, and all of the navigation features we love are yet at that place. The Magic Remote offers motion control, letting you wave your remote to motility an on-screen cursor, providing ane of the near intuitive indicate-and-click navigation experiences offered on a smart TV.

(Image credit: LG)

The band-shaped directional pad has a clickable whorl wheel in the center, instead of the simple enter button used on remote controls from competing companies. The improver of scrolling is a small touch, just it makes a huge difference every bit you piece of work your way through pages of Netflix recommendations or YouTube videos, and it's a feature nosotros wish other manufacturers would adopt.

Bottom line

The LG UM7300 is the well-nigh basic 4K smart Television offered by LG, and it shows. From the elementary design to the ho-hum performance and limited HDR support, the LG UM7300 is all about the price. And, since information technology routinely shows upwardly on bestseller lists from retailers like Amazon and Walmart, it's clearly doing just fine in the sales department based on the price alone. Simply for our money, there'due south a lot more that goes into value than the dollar figure on the tag.

We recommend the Vizio M-Series Breakthrough, a midrange model that sells for a similar price and offers better color and dynamic range, thanks to backlight with local dimming and a quantum-dot display that boosts the effulgence and vibrancy of the picture. Information technology is worth noting, notwithstanding, that the LG UM7300 volition offering a more than robust smart TV feel than the Vizio, and if streaming apps and smart domicile features are what yous really want in a TV, and so the UM7300 is a decent choice, then long as you can accept the imperfections in picture quality.
